Instagram lets users customize their feed by topic, not just follow

Instagram is fragmenting its core feed from a social graph organized by who you follow into a topic-based attention market, giving users explicit control over content categories while the company retains algorithmic curation within each segment. This mirrors TikTok's dominance by decoupling discovery from follower relationships. The move reflects Instagram's assessment that algorithmic feeds optimized for engagement have eroded user trust enough to warrant transparency as a competitive feature. The expansion to moods and people requests suggests Meta is building modularity into the feed itself, essentially creating multiple feeds inside one app to compete with users' growing habit of context-switching across platforms.
